About 9 Cavell Walk
9 Cavell Walk is a three-bedroom mid-terrace house in Stevenage (SG2 0QD). It has a recorded floor area of 88 m² (around 947 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(September 2013) shows a D (score 63),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 80). The latest certificate is from September 2013,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Other recorded features include a conservatory.
Today's modelled estimate of £330,000 sits 90.2% above the 2013 sale of £173,500. Last changed hands 12 years ago, in December 2013.
